31.1Sfvdl# GENERIC machine description file
41.1Sfvdl# 
51.1Sfvdl# This machine description file is used to generate the default NetBSD
61.1Sfvdl# kernel.  The generic kernel does not include all options, subsystems
71.1Sfvdl# and device drivers, but should be useful for most applications.
81.1Sfvdl#
91.1Sfvdl# The machine description file can be customised for your specific
101.1Sfvdl# machine to reduce the kernel size and improve its performance.
111.1Sfvdl#
121.1Sfvdl# For further information on compiling NetBSD kernels, see the config(8)
131.1Sfvdl# man page.
141.1Sfvdl#
151.1Sfvdl# For further information on hardware support for this architecture, see
161.1Sfvdl# the intro(4) man page.  For further information about kernel options
171.1Sfvdl# for this architecture, see the options(4) man page.  For an explanation
181.1Sfvdl# of each device driver in this file see the section 4 man page for the
191.1Sfvdl# device.

391.1Sfvdl# The following options override the memory sizes passed in from the boot
401.1Sfvdl# block.  Use them *only* if the boot block is unable to determine the correct
411.1Sfvdl# values.  Note that the BIOS may *correctly* report less than 640k of base
421.1Sfvdl# memory if the extended BIOS data area is located at the top of base memory
431.1Sfvdl# (as is the case on most recent systems).
441.1Sfvdl#options 	REALBASEMEM=639		# size of base memory (in KB)
451.1Sfvdl#options 	REALEXTMEM=15360	# size of extended memory (in KB)

4611.1Sfvdl# IDE drives
4621.1Sfvdl# Flags are used only with controllers that support DMA operations
4631.1Sfvdl# and mode settings (e.g. some pciide controllers)
4641.1Sfvdl# The lowest order four bits (rightmost digit) of the flags define the PIO
4651.1Sfvdl# mode to use, the next set of four bits the DMA mode and the third set the
4661.1Sfvdl# UltraDMA mode. For each set of four bits, the 3 lower bits define the mode
4671.1Sfvdl# to use, and the last bit must be 1 for this setting to be used.
4681.1Sfvdl# For DMA and UDMA, 0xf (1111) means 'disable'.
4691.1Sfvdl# 0x0fac means 'use PIO mode 4, DMA mode 2, disable UltraDMA'.
4701.1Sfvdl# (0xc=1100, 0xa=1010, 0xf=1111)
4711.1Sfvdl# 0x0000 means "use whatever the drive claims to support".
4721.11Sbouyerwd*	at atabus? drive ? flags 0x0000
